Contrarian: The Decoupling Thesis Is a Trap

The prevailing narrative in crypto is that the asset class has decoupled from traditional macro. It is a hedge against inflation, a store of value, a digital gold. But that narrative is a lure. 'Exit liquidity is just another person's thesis.' The decoupling thesis works only as long as the macro environment remains stable. When a shock hits the energy substrate, the correlation between crypto and traditional assets reappears—not because of sentiment, but because of cost.

Consider the mining ecosystem. Bitcoin's hash rate is dominated by regions with cheap energy: the United States, Kazakhstan, Russia, and increasingly, the Middle East. If Hormuz risk drives up oil prices, the cost of natural gas (used for mining) also rises. Miners with thin margins will be forced to sell Bitcoin to cover electricity costs. That selling pressure is real, and it is not priced into the current spot price.

Regulation is the lagging indicator of chaos. If Iran escalates, the US Treasury will tighten sanctions on crypto to prevent evasion. The same tools used to freeze Iranian assets will be applied to DeFi protocols that facilitate cross-border payments. The market is not pricing that regulatory risk either. It assumes that crypto operates outside the legacy system. But the legacy system still controls the banks, the stablecoin issuers, and the internet infrastructure.
